📚 Historical Context
In the book of Deuteronomy, Moses is delivering his final instructions to the Israelites as they prepare to enter the Promised Land after their exodus from Egypt. This verse is part of a covenant renewal ceremony on Mount Ebal, where the Levites were commanded to loudly proclaim the curses that would result from disobeying God's laws, emphasizing the seriousness of their commitment. This ritual served to unite the community in their covenant obligations and remind them of the consequences of their actions.
